How it works

Connect Snowflake and sync in both directions. Read tables, views, or custom SQL into other systems, or load data into Snowflake from over a hundred sources with tables created and columns migrated automatically as your source schemas change.

Loading uses Snowflake's own internal stage, so there is no bucket for you to provision, region match, or grant access to. Polytomic uploads staged files, runs COPY, merges through a transient table when there is a key, and clears up afterwards.

How to set up

Key pair authentication is the recommended option and accepts passphrase protected private keys. Password authentication also works but Snowflake is deprecating it. Role, region, and other driver settings can be supplied through additional parameters.

How to get connected
  1. 1Create a dedicated Snowflake role and warehouse for Polytomic
  2. 2Grant usage on the warehouse, database, and schema, plus select on sources
  3. 3For destinations, grant create table, insert, alter, truncate, and drop
  4. 4Generate a key pair and register the public key on the Snowflake user
  5. 5In Polytomic, add the Snowflake connection and test it
  6. 6Select tables or build a model, set a schedule, and click Save
